can i make it lower?

so i lowered my car again first i did it with eibachs and that was good for a while now i have st coilovers so i wanted the max drop and i thought it would look good, but one problem i bought new tires too, i went from a 265/35/22 to a 255/30/22 so i lost about one inch n tire profile, so i went from the max drop and i havwe about 1 inch gap in the front but the back is about 2-2.5 maybe 3, could i do something to lower the back
